ZIP 55373 and ZIP 55379 are ZIP Code areas in Minnesota.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 55379 has the higher population (49,084 vs 5,725 in ZIP 55373). ZIP 55379 has the higher median household income ($109,824 vs $95,273 in ZIP 55373). ZIP 55379 has the higher median home value ($366,300 vs $285,000 in ZIP 55373).
